3. How does the REacton grade differ from standard commercial grades?

REacton grade undergoes additional refining to reduce trace impurities (e.g., other rare earths, transition metals) below 100 ppm, which is critical for applications like optical materials where even minor contaminants affect performance.

4. What precautions should be taken during storage to maintain purity?

Store in a tightly sealed container under inert gas (argon/nitrogen) to prevent moisture absorption and oxidation. Avoid exposure to acidic vapors, as terbium oxides can react with strong acids over time.
